Animales En peligro de Extincion

I

Atún Rojo
(Bluefin)
Features: Atlantic bluefin tuna can exceed 450 kg in weight, and rival the black marlin and Atlantic blue marlin. Throughout history bluefin tuna has been highly prized as foodfor humans. The market value was already high since the time of Ancient Greece and is known to the Phoenicians traded with their flesh. Bluefin tuna is also the basis of a more lucrative fisheries in the world.
Location: Pelagic ecosystems habitat in the Atlantic Ocean and adjacent seas, particularly the Mediterranean Sea.
Threats: is on the brink of commercial extinction because ofinternational trade and overfishing, illegal in much. According to scientists, the breeding population has declined by over 85%. currently banned their capture.

El Águila Harpía
(The Harpy Eagle)
Features: It is the most powerful raptor, the average size of the female harpy eagle are 100 cm long, 200 cm wingspan and a weight of 9 kg. Male has smaller dimensions: up to 196 cm wingspan and weighing about8 kg. It is the second largest eagle in the world, surpassed in size (distance between the ends of the wings) only by the Philippine eagle.
Location: It stretches from southern Mexico to southeastern Brazil. Lives in large undisturbed forests, both in the Atlantic and in the Pacific, between the coast and the 2,000 meters altura. In Costa Rica have a report of this bird in recent years in theOsa Peninsula. It has been seen in the tropical and subtropical forests, especially in mountain or hilly areas. From Mexico to Venezuela, Colombia, Guyana, Brazil, Ecuador, Peru, Bolivia and Paraguay.
Threats: It is very probable that there are only a few animals, threatened every day scaled by the indiscriminate use of pesticides and deforestation. The Harpy habitat is being fragmented and reducedday by day. In addition, copies continuously captured for zoos, museums or private collections. This reduces the amount of copies.

El Cóndor Andino
(The Andean Condor)
Features: The Condor is a large bird with certain sedentarymonogamous and nocturnal. His head is bare of feathers and the male is easily differentiated from the female by its crest or caruncle bearing on the front and peak, plus the male is larger and has the iris yellowish brown while the her companion is red, his vision i s really extraordinary
Location: It lies along the Andes and in Venezuela can be found specifically in the Andean Cordillera and theSierra de Perija.
Threats: extinction of large mammals American and reducing species such as deer and tapirs have contributed to the decline of populations of these predators. Additionally, since the period of conquest has been affected by hunting and even hunting
